St. Augustine's Indian Residential School was a school in Sechelt, British Columbia, Canada, from 1904 to 1975, which was part of the Canadian Indian residential school system.[1][2] Former pupils include actor Pat John who played in The Beachcombers for 19 years.[3] The school was within 0.25 miles (0.40 km) of the commercial centre of Sechelt,[1] and was also known as Sechelt Residential School, Sechelt Industrial School and Our Lady of Lourdes.[4]
